Description
Return to Roots is a roguelike co-op horror game for up to 6 players. Complete randomly generated floors by locating items, consuming or otherwise using them to your advantage, and composting them in your elevator. Coordinate with your team to avoid unique monsters of varying danger levels. Visit the shop to buy items upgrades for your elevator, and pick upgrade cards at the end of each successful floor. There's a terrible secret lying in the roots of the great tree you're living in, and it's your job to discover what it is.
FLOORS
Each level in Return to Roots is unique - themed and randomly generated, with each map having different layouts, vibes, and custom music. You may be running across a mall and visiting each store to look for compostable items, going for a view in the garden , or checking into your room at the hotel. Every map provides a unique challenge.
ITEMS
Items of different rarities are scattered across each floor. These can be consumable items that turn into waste when used, passive items that give you on-hit effects, stat boosts and more, or burden items which are dangerous or otherwise detrimental to hold, though are worth more than regular items. There are 100+ unique items to discover. Whether it be a dodgeball you can throw to distract enemies that can hear you, a cute gleech whose value increases when giving blood, or a legendary cursed skull that offers immense speed and stamina efficiency at the cost of killing you when damage is taken, each and every item offers different strategic benefits
MONSTERS
As you and your team descend further into the tree, more and more dangerous monsters will start to appear. Some may be simple , like a goat that copies the sounds of other monsters. Some might not pose any danger at all, like a mischievous trader who might scam you. But, some may be extremely dangerous; a snail that devours items on the floor and grows big enough to swallow you whole. A living birdhouse that moves in short , lightning quick bursts. A pepper jester who is desperate to entertain , lest he takes on a horrifying new form. Teamwork is important in Return to Roots - your lives depend on how well you know your enemy.
METAPROGRESSION
When a run is completed or your entire team dies, you gain credits. These can be spent on equipment - reusable items that can be equipped at any time during your run. You can only bring a few of these items with you, so be sure to craft a build that suits your playstyle and synergizes well together. Running out of stamina often? Bring the Mini Broomstick to get a small amount of stamina back whenever you pick up an item. Can't lug enough items back to the elevator? Bring the Baby Snail along to swallow floor items and later spit them back up as a mucus ball worth as much as all of the swallowed items. Some equipment are passive , some are conditional , and some can be used in exchange for water , a resource that can be replenished in many ways.
AND MORE...
Shrines are small structures that can be interacted with throughout each floor, offering item duplication, trading, refreshment, and more. Finishing a floor allows you to vote for random upgrade cards that benefit your team or elevator. Certain items may be combined/crafted together. If you can't finish a floor, you can use an Emergency Skip.. but the next floor will be especially difficult. There's a myriad of things to do in Return to Roots, and it's up to you to discover them.
